    If you want to do something different while in Savannah, Blade and Bull Ax Throwing is the place to…read morevisit. Located about a mile from downtown Savannah. It is very easy to find via vehicle or on foot. Our ax throwing instructors were great and patient while teaching and demonstrating the fundamentals.  After about 10 minutes we were able to throw the axes properly. You are given a choice of several axes with different blade weights and handle lengths to throw. There are more than 10 different games you can play in the eight lanes. Our allotted time expired faster than expected due to the fun we experienced. Overall, it was a great way to kill time for individuals and groups. Highly recommended.

    SOOOOOOOO FUN! My husband and I were sans kids on one of our last weeks in Savannah before the…read moremove. The kids were spending some QT with their grandparents while we dealt with the moving madness. I missed them so much, but this means Date Nights without having to find child care. Honey, let's go axe throwing! Sure, why not?! We went on a double date with our good friends and it was such a fun start to the evening! - Parking - Private lot, but small. There's about 10 spaces. - TLC - The owner and the team are amazing! From my first phone call for info, all the way to the end of our axe throwing sesh, they were so helpful and friendly. - How It Works - You can make a reservation online which is a very easy website to navigate. Choose location and tap "Book online now". There is a calendar with time slots. Or, if you're like me and like to talk to human beings who can process my inquisitive mind with random questions, you can call and they'll be happy to assist and also make the reservation for you. Lanes have a max capacity of 6 people. Not sure how they set you up for parties of more than 6. Just ask the nice humans. When you arrive, you have to fill out the waiver. This was quick and easy as there is a QR code at the reception that leads you to the waiver online. Read and sign and once you get that out of the way, you are shown to your lane and an Axe Throwing coach will give you a little briefing on safety and tips of how to throw the axe. I read online that it's also BYOA(xe)! I actually got the axe on the board!!! Aaaaaaaand I got BULLSEYE (once). That's all that counts haha. There is a playbook at every lane so you can actually play games... I was just trying to get it on the board haha. Blade & Bull is located inside Southbound Brewing. If you get thirsty, you can walk over to the Southbound side and grab some beers that you are welcomed to take back to B&B. B&B does NOT sell any beverages or snacks so don't go hungry. Also, Southbound does not have anything non alcoholic. Stay safe, Friends!
